More motor-driven refers to something that requires or utilizes more power coming from an electric or gasoline-powered motor. Some synonyms for this phrase include more motorized, more engine-powered, more electric-driven, more mechanically-driven, and more powered by machinery. These terms indicate that an object or device relies heavily on an external source of energy to function effectively. Examples of objects that are more motor-driven include motorized vehicles, heavy machinery, power tools, and home appliances. The popularity of motor-driven machines has significantly increased in recent years due to their efficiency and effectiveness in completing tasks. The use of electricity and gasoline as a source of power has been a great leap from the use of manual labor in various industries.
